Well, I am taking a break from painter and my tablet to learn a little about photoshop and its filters, and when I saw, I was already going deep on its features. Its fascinating!
For this pic, I used most the filters "Glass" and "Displace" to make the glassy hair. and also used many layers with diferents modes to comp�se the overlaping. ah, I also used a lot of "Layer mask" and "Layer Blending options".
